Interior LED help

I attempted to install some LEDs in the front dome lights of my 2010 C300, using this DIY: https://mbworld.org/forums/c-clas...t-removal.html
They didn't slide right in and kept pushing the receiver piece up into the top console, so I opened the console and removed the plastic receiver pieces to insert them that way. When I put them back in, the lights wouldn't come on. They also now won't come on with the stock bulbs put back in. Any ideas on what I may have done?
Sun roof buttons still work, but the lights refuse to come on. The same leds I used in most of the other interior lights on the car, and they worked & fit fine. But in these specific lights, I had to use a lot more force.
I thought these were supposed to be the same size led as the trunk light and the door lights? I bought the led's from CARiD according to what they said would fit my car.

Any suggestions on how to remedy this would be much appreciated. Thanks

There's a possibility that you might've insert them in the wrong polarity.

I had that problem when fitting mine; I just had to turn the LEDs the other way around and reinsert them again.
